Tax Filing Deadlines And Late Filing Guide
In the United States, the deadline for individual tax filings is April 15 each year, while fiscal year taxpayers have a due date four months later. A 6-month automatic extension can be requested, but payments must still be made on time during the interim. Those who have not filed should address this promptly, and military personnel are granted an additional 180-day grace period.

IRS Offers Free Tax Extension New Deadline October 15
Facing the US tax deadline, experts offer three free online methods to request an extension until October 15th: filing Form 4868, selecting the extension option during tax payment, and using IRS Free File. It's crucial to understand that an extension only extends the filing deadline, not the payment deadline. Late payments will still incur penalties and interest. Taxpayers are advised to plan ahead, utilize tax tools to estimate their tax liability, choose the appropriate extension method, and maintain good tax records throughout the year.

Free Tax Filing Tool A Deep Dive into IRS Free Filing Services
The IRS has launched a free tax filing program that offers eligible taxpayers a quick, secure, and free online filing service. This initiative collaborates with multiple tax software companies, allowing users with an annual income below $84,000 to easily complete their tax returns while protecting personal information and enhancing filing efficiency.

Understanding Form 5471: A Crucial Document for U.S. Taxpayers with Foreign Companies
Form 5471 is primarily used for U.S. citizens and residents to report their investments and management in foreign companies. Submission requirements include owning shares of a foreign company or serving as an executive or director. The information required is related to the ownership percentage and must be submitted by the tax filing deadline; late submissions incur significant penalties. Compliance is crucial to avoid fines.

Sales Tax Filing and Payment Guide
Sales tax is an indirect tax applicable to the sale of goods or services, where businesses act as agents responsible for collecting and remitting the tax. Sales tax filing involves reporting detailed information about sales transactions, and regulations vary by state, requiring businesses to maintain accurate records for compliance. Online sales tax filing can typically be completed through the state’s finance department, making it essential for businesses to understand local regulations.
